Filters:
clear
Country: United Kingdom

screen separators in Folkestone

About 2 results.

Leas Cliff Hall

thumb_up 447 likes
rate_review 20 Reviews
favorite 2148 favorites
Leas Cliff Hall, The Leas, CT20 2DZ Folkestone, United Kingdom

The Channel Suite is situated in the Leas Cliff Hall and is available to hire for any and every occasion.

The Channel Suite

thumb_up 447 likes
rate_review 20 Reviews
favorite 2148 favorites
Leas Cliff Hall, The Leas, CT20 2DZ Folkestone, United Kingdom

The Channel Suite is situated in the Leas Cliff Hall and is available to hire for any and every occasion.

  • 1